In 1996, when The Taliban first came into power, they harshly took rights away from Afghans and forced them to follow Islam. Employment, education and sports for women, movies, television, kite-flyng, clapping during sports-events, and things such as pork, pig oil, alcohol, computers, VCRs, wine, lobster, nail polish, firecrackers, and music were prohibited. Afghans disagreed with The Taliban, and formed a group named the Northern Alliance which fought The Taliban directly.
